Well, a hardware-switched-to-PAL-after-boot NTSC machine doesn't behave any differently than a software-switched-to NTSC-after-boot PAL machine.
(Yes, it does: the wall clock runs fast on the latter A500 - that's why big box machines use the PSU's tick for the CIA timer.)
You can happily throw the switch dozens of times while the machine is running without any problems.
